Research Areas

Currently working on Sputter Deposition of Cadmium Zinc Telluride Films. Cadmium Zinc Telluride (CZT) is a high band gap material. It has a potential for a top cell in a multi junction solar cell and also holds a promise to form an electron reflector when deposited on the back of CdTe devices. My focus is to carry out deposition of CZT films by RF sputtering on various devices structures. The structures are then characterized by using different tools and the performance is tested under standard conditions.
